Transaction a3340dc013429259c52b02318fd59c7c63f55a0eff2f4775b1a1668fb9a8c571

1 Input
2 Outputs
  • a3340dc013429259c52b02318fd59c7c63f55a0eff2f4775b1a1668fb9a8c571:0
  • value  29000000
    address  32ut7vJH8vwgsUMTrLijjpND8LrtRAh7jb
  • a3340dc013429259c52b02318fd59c7c63f55a0eff2f4775b1a1668fb9a8c571:1
  • value  70601960
    address  39nHVqCnvGHXXzWkCj6gdtnUanRnYCQUqF